description The clinical picture of notohedrosis of the experimental cats in 100 % of cases was manifested by skin lesions in the head area ( forehead, bridge of the nose, superbrow arches and auricles).  During the experiment in animals, at the intensity of invasion of Notoedres cati of 5.8 ± 0.3 specimens of live ticks  in the examined smear showed  such symptoms as the appearance of small nodules and blisters (in 40 % of experimental cases), blisters, where the fur partially or completely fell out (60 %), moderate itching (30 %), general depression (20 %), local soreness including the jaws, which prevented the consumption of food, especially solid food (30 %), and as result of weight loss (10 %). According to the intensity of the invasion of 15.1 ± 0.61 specimens of live fleas in the examined swab, the clinical picture in the affected cats was more pronounced. Thus, small nodules and blisters were detected on the affected areas of the scalp in 20 % of the experimental cats; blisters with partial or complete loss of hair on them in 80 %, moderately expressed itching in 50 %, general depression in 60 %, local soreness of the jaws and difficult consumption of solid food in 80 %, weight loss and exhaustion in 60 %. In the leukogram of the blood of the cats of the experimental group, significant changes were also found compared to healthy animals. Thus, basophils (2.70 ± 0.09 %), appeared in the blood of sick animals, which were not found in healthy animals. The concentration of eosinophils was 3 times higher (2.70 ± 0.08 %) in healthy cats and 8.20 ± 0.31 % in sick cats (Р < 0.001). Among the changes in the ratio of neutrophils in the blood of cats with notohedrosis, it was noted the appearance of young neutrophils (4.80 ± 0.18 %), an increase in the number of rod-shaped neutrophils by 69.2 % (from 5.20 ± 0.25 % in healthy animals to 8.80 ± 0.32 % in sick animals, Р < 0.001) and a decrease in segment nuclear by 26.7 % (from 69.30 ± 3.26 tо 50.80 ± 1.71 % respectively, Р < 0,01). At a high intensity of the invasion of pathogens of notohedrosis (15.1 ± 0.61 specimens of live ticks in the examined swear) the changes in the morphological composition of the blood were even more pronounced. Thus, a decrease in the content of erythrocytes by 16.2 % was noted (from 7.44 ± 0.23 Т/L in healthy cats to 6.07 ± 0.19 Т/L in the infected cats, Р < 0.01) and an increase in the number of leukocytes was noted 2.4 times (from 13.90 ± 0.62 tо 32.80 ± 0.85 g/L respectively, Р < 0.001).
